This pull request addresses a bug where the invocation_id was not being included in the final model response event when LLM flows utilized tools and output schemas. The change ensures that this crucial identifier is consistently returned, thereby improving traceability and debugging capabilities for these specific interaction patterns within the system.

Highlights

  • Event Creation Enhancement: The create_final_model_response_event function in _output_schema_processor.py has been updated to explicitly pass the invocation_id from the invocation_context to the Event constructor. This ensures that the unique identifier for an invocation is always present in the final model response event.

Code Review

This pull request fixes a bug where the invocation_id was not being set on events created when using an output_schema with tools. The change correctly passes the invocation_id from the invocation_context when creating the final model response event. This is a good fix. I've also suggested propagating the branch from the context for better consistency and to support sub-agent scenarios correctly.
